Auto merge of #133068 - jieyouxu:download-rustc-default-only-for-tools, r=clubby789
Use `download-rustc=false` global default, `if-unchanged` for tools and library profiles, and make `rust.debug-assertions=true` inhibit downloading CI rustc

- Use `download-rustc = false` as global default.
    - Use `download-rustc = 'if-unchanged'` for tools and library profiles.
- Make `rust.debug-assertions = true` inhibit downloading CI rustc because alt rustc builds do not yet have rustc debug assertions enabled.

Fixes #133132.
